Submarine Electricity Transmission Market - By Types & Applications (2011-2018)
Submarine electricity transmission allows the transfer of energy below the surface of water. Submarine power cables are major transmission cables for carrying electric power beneath water. Demand for submarine cables is growing as countries and regions make commitments to offshore renewable power generation.
The global Submarine Electricity Transmission Market is segmented firstly on the basis of the cable used in them such as Mass-Impregnated Cables, Self-Contained Fluid-Filled Cables, Extruded Insulation Cables. Secondly, it is segmented on the basis of its application covering Power Supply to Offshore Facilities, transmission of power from renewable offshore sources, transfer of cheap power generated on natural or artificial islands to the mainland. Lastly, the market is segmented based on the various geographical markets such as North America, Europe, Asia-Pacific, and Rest of the World (ROW).
